Hoppa till huvudinnehållet
HemSQL

course

Joining Data in SQL

GrundläggandeNivå
Uppdaterad 2026-04
Level up your SQL knowledge and learn to join tables together, apply relational set theory, and work with subqueries.
Starta Kursen Gratis
SQLData Manipulation
2 tim - 3 tim
3,950 XP
320K+
Intyg om genomförd kurs

Skapa ditt gratis konto

Fortsätt Med GoogleVisa fler alternativ

eller


Genom att fortsätta godkänner du våra Användarvillkor, vår Integritetspolicy och att dina uppgifter lagras i USA.

Älskad av elever på tusentals företag

Group

Tränar du ett team?

Prova för företag

Kursbeskrivning

Joining data is an essential skill in data analysis, enabling you to draw information from separate tables together into a single, meaningful set of results. In this comprehensive course on joining data, you'll delve into the intricacies of table joins and relational set theory, learning how to optimize your queries for efficient data retrieval.

Understand Data Joining Fundamentals

You will learn how to work with multiple tables in SQL by navigating and extracting data from various tables within a SQL database using various join types, including inner joins, outer joins, and cross joins. With practice, you'll gain the knowledge of how to select the appropriate join method.

Explore Advanced Data Manipulation Techniques

Next up, you'll explore set theory principles such as unions, intersects, and except clauses, as well as discover the power of nested queries in SQL. Every step is accompanied by exercises and opportunities to apply the theory and grow your confidence in SQL.

Förkunskaper

Intermediate SQL
1

Kombinera data vertikalt

  • Stacka rader med UNION

    Stapla rader från flera tabeller till ett enhetligt resultat, och veta när stapling (snarare än en join) är rätt tillvägagångssätt för att kombinera data.

Starta Kursen Gratis
2

Kombinera data horisontellt

  • Behåll alla rader med LEFT JOIN

    Berika en bastabell med ytterligare data utan att förlora några rader, och förstå när en left join är rätt val — specifikt när inte alla rader i din primärtabell har en matchning i den andra tabellen.

  • Behåll matchande rader med INNER JOIN

    Kombinera endast de rader som matchar mellan tabeller, förstå hur inner joins skiljer sig från left joins och välj mellan dem baserat på om rader som saknar matchning är viktiga för din analys.

  • Join på flera kolumner

    Sammanfoga tabeller korrekt när ingen enskild kolumn unikt identifierar matchande rader, och identifiera konsekvenserna av att välja felaktiga join-kolumner.

Starta Kursen Gratis
Joining Data in SQL
Kurs
slutförd

Få ett intyg om genomförd kurs

Lägg till denna merit i din LinkedIn-profil, ditt CV eller din meritförteckning
Dela det på sociala medier och i din prestationsbedömning
Anmäl Dig Nu

Gå med över 19 miljoner elever och börja Joining Data in SQL i dag!

Skapa ditt gratis konto

Fortsätt Med GoogleVisa fler alternativ

eller


Genom att fortsätta godkänner du våra Användarvillkor, vår Integritetspolicy och att dina uppgifter lagras i USA.

Utveckla dina datakunskaper med DataCamp för mobilen

Gör framsteg när du är på språng med våra mobila kurser och dagliga 5-minuters kodningsutmaningar.